he Pan-American Highway (see below for its name in all languages) is a network of roads nearly 48,000 kilometres (29,800 miles) in total length. Except for an 87 kilometre (54 mi) rainforest gap, the road links the mainland nations of the Americas in a connected highway system. According to The Guinness Book of World Records, the Pan-American Highway is the world's longest "motorable road".

The Pan-American Highway travels through the following 15 countries:

   * Canada (unofficially)
   * United States (unofficially)
   * Mexico
   * Guatemala
   * El Salvador
   * Honduras
   * Nicaragua
   * Costa Rica
   * Panama
   * Colombia
   * Ecuador
   * Peru
   * Chile
   * Argentina

Important spurs also lead into Bolivia, Brazil, Paraguay, Uruguay and Venezuela
